随着移动互联网的飞速发展,微信作为一款拥有庞大用户群体的社交平台,其应用场景越来越广泛,微信小程序和H5页面已经成为企业、个人拓展业务的重要工具,本篇教程将带你深入探索微信网站的开发流程,从基础概念到高级技巧,为你提供全方位的学习路径。
了解微信小程序与H5页面的区别
小程序的特点:
- 轻量化:无需下载安装即可使用,用户体验更佳。
- 便捷性:支持扫码即用,方便快捷。
- 安全性:微信官方严格审核,确保安全可靠。
H5页面的特点:
- 灵活性:易于开发和维护,适合快速上线项目。
- 兼容性:跨平台兼容性强,适用于多种设备。
- 成本效益:开发成本低,投入产出比高。
选择合适的开发框架和技术栈
常见前端技术栈:
- React: 强大的组件化和状态管理能力,适合大型复杂应用。
- Vue.js: 易于上手,简洁明了,非常适合小型和中型项目。
- Angular: 结构化良好,适合需要高度定制化的应用。
后端技术选择:
- Node.js: 快速响应和高性能,适合实时交互的应用。
- Django/Flask: 稳定可靠,适合数据驱动的应用。
- Spring Boot: 集成度高,适合企业级应用。
创建微信小程序的基本步骤
第一步:注册开发者账号
在微信公众平台官网注册开发者账号,获取必要的API密钥等信息。
图片来源于网络,如有侵权联系删除
第二步:搭建开发环境
安装微信开发者工具,配置好本地开发环境。
第三步:编写代码
使用微信官方提供的SDK或第三方库(如uni-app)进行开发。
第四步:调试和测试
利用开发者工具进行模拟调试,确保功能正常无误。
图片来源于网络,如有侵权联系删除
第五步:提交审核
完成所有准备工作后,向微信官方提交审核申请。
设计H5页面的最佳实践
用户界面设计原则:
- 简约美观:保持简洁的设计风格,提升用户体验。
- 响应式布局:适应不同屏幕尺寸,保证在不同设备上都能良好显示。
- 交互流畅:注重细节处理,提高用户的操作体验。
性能优化策略:
- 压缩图片和文件:减小加载时间,提升页面速度。
- 异步加载资源:按需加载,减少初次加载压力。
- 缓存机制:合理利用浏览器缓存,加快重复访问的速度。
安全性与隐私保护措施
数据加密传输:
- 使用HTTPS协议进行数据传输,防止中间人攻击。
- 对敏感数据进行加密存储和处理。
用户权限控制:
- 实现细粒度的权限管理,确保只有授权用户才能访问特定资源。
- 定期更新安全补丁,防范潜在漏洞。
法律法规遵守:
- 遵守相关法律法规,保护用户个人信息不被滥用。
- 公开透明的隐私政策,让用户清楚了解自己的权益。
推广与运营技巧
社交媒体营销:
- 利用微信公众号、朋友圈等渠道进行推广。
- 结合热点话题制作有趣的内容吸引用户关注。
活动策划:
- 定期举办线上线下活动,增强用户粘性。
- 通过抽奖、积分兑换等方式激励用户参与互动。
数据分析与应用:
- 运用数据分析工具了解用户行为习惯,调整产品策略。
- 根据反馈意见不断优化改进产品和服务质量。
通过以上详细的介绍和实践指导,相信你已经对微信网站的开发有了更加深刻的认识,无论是从小白到进阶开发者,还是想要拓展自己在移动端的业务能力,都需要不断地学习和实践,希望这篇文章能够成为你在学习道路上的一盏明灯,照亮前行的道路!
标签: #微信网站开发教程
评论列表